Class AvailabilityPeriodCollection

Class AvailabilityPeriodCollection

Namespace: Aspose.Tasks
Assembly: Aspose.Tasks.dll (25.2.0)

Représente une collection qui contient des objets Aspose.Tasks.AvailabilityPeriod.

public class AvailabilityPeriodCollection : IList<availabilityperiod>, ICollection<availabilityperiod>, IEnumerable<availabilityperiod>, IEnumerable

Héritage

objectAvailabilityPeriodCollection

Implémente

IList<availabilityperiod>, ICollection<availabilityperiod>, IEnumerable<availabilityperiod>, IEnumerable

Membres hérités

object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()

Propriétés

Count

Obtient le nombre d’éléments contenus dans cette collection.

public int Count { get; }

Valeur de la propriété

int

IsReadOnly

Obtient une valeur indiquant si cette collection est en lecture seule ; sinon, false.

public bool IsReadOnly { get; }

Valeur de la propriété

bool

ParentResource

Obtient le parent Aspose.Tasks.Resource pour cet objet. Objet parent Aspose.Tasks.Resource pour cette collection.

public Resource ParentResource { get; }

Valeur de la propriété

Resource

this[int]

Renvoie ou définit l’élément à l’index spécifié.

public AvailabilityPeriod this[int index] { get; set; }

Valeur de la propriété

AvailabilityPeriod

Méthodes

Add(AvailabilityPeriod)

Ajoute l’élément spécifié à cette collection.

public void Add(AvailabilityPeriod item)

Paramètres

item AvailabilityPeriod

l’élément spécifié à ajouter à cette collection.

Clear()

Supprime tous les éléments de cette collection.

public void Clear()

Contains(AvailabilityPeriod)

Renvoie true si l’élément spécifié est trouvé dans cette collection ; sinon, false.

public bool Contains(AvailabilityPeriod item)

Paramètres

item AvailabilityPeriod

l’élément spécifié à trouver.

Renvoie

bool

true si l’élément spécifié est trouvé dans cette collection ; sinon, false.

CopyTo(AvailabilityPeriod[], int)

Copie les éléments de cette collection dans le tableau spécifié, en commençant à l’index spécifié du tableau.

public void CopyTo(AvailabilityPeriod[] array, int arrayIndex)

Paramètres

array AvailabilityPeriod[]

le tableau unidimensionnel spécifié dans lequel copier les éléments

arrayIndex int

l’index de base zéro du tableau spécifié où commence la copie.

GetEnumerator()

Renvoie un énumérateur pour cette collection.

public IEnumerator<availabilityperiod> GetEnumerator()

Renvoie

IEnumerator<AvailabilityPeriod&gt;

un énumérateur pour cette collection.

IndexOf(AvailabilityPeriod)

Détermine l’index de l’élément spécifié dans cette collection.

public int IndexOf(AvailabilityPeriod item)

Paramètres

item AvailabilityPeriod

l’élément spécifié à localiser dans cette collection.

Renvoie

int

l’index de l’élément spécifié s’il est trouvé ; sinon, -1.

Insert(int, AvailabilityPeriod)

Insère l’élément spécifié à l’index spécifié.

public void Insert(int index, AvailabilityPeriod item)

Paramètres

index int

l’index de base zéro spécifié à laquelle l’élément doit être inséré.

item AvailabilityPeriod

l’élément spécifié à insérer dans cette collection.

Remove(AvailabilityPeriod)

Supprime la première occurrence d’un objet spécifique de cette collection.

public bool Remove(AvailabilityPeriod item)

Paramètres

item AvailabilityPeriod

l’objet spécifié à supprimer.

Renvoie

bool

true si l’objet spécifié a été supprimé avec succès de cette collection ; sinon, false.

RemoveAt(int)

Supprime un élément à l’index spécifié.

public void RemoveAt(int index)

Paramètres

index int

l’index de base zéro spécifié pour supprimer un élément.

 Français